Love the show. The comments about plugs/ads are weird. Do these people listen to/follow podcasts online at all? The alternative to what they're doing is to go the customer pay route and that is death for most podcasts.

$5/mth for each subscriber? That works for the cream of the crop in the podcast world with hundreds of thousands/millions of subscribers, it doesn't work for anyone else. They have a great product with a sizeable user base. With that you do sponsors and ads, full stop. Insane to complain about that, it's literally the way the podcast world works.
